Everyone has a story . . . but will they get the happy ending they deserve?
Emilia has just returned to her idyllic Cotswold hometown to rescue the family business. Nightingale Books is a dream come true for book-lovers, but the best stories aren’t just within the pages of the books she sells – Emilia’s customers have their own tales to tell.
There’s the lady of the manor who is hiding a secret close to her heart; the single dad looking for books to share with his son but who isn’t quite what he seems; and the desperately shy chef trying to find the courage to talk to her crush . . .
And as for Emilia’s story, can she keep the promise she made to her father and save Nightingale Books?
My Thoughts:
What a superb read. Veronica Henry is one of my favourite authors and when I saw this book out I knew I had to read it. You get to meet some interesting characters along the way in this book and learn a little about each one of them. This is a friendly and affectionately tale of everyday life in the Cotswold Village of Peasbrook, I couldn’t put the book down it gripped me right from the start. Veronica Henry has written a brilliant book here and I think it has to be one of my favourites of hers.
